An earthing plate is a critical component used in electrical systems to provide a safe and reliable path for fault currents to flow to the ground, thus preventing damage to equipment and ensuring human safety.

Key Features Of Earthing Plate
Made from high-quality materials, such as copper or aluminum, for excellent conductivity and durability.
Available in various plate sizes to suit specific applications and space constraints.
Can be designed with a range of thicknesses to accommodate different load capacities and environmental conditions.
Features a robust and weather-resistant design to withstand harsh environments.
